CONTINEUM THERAPEUTICS REPORTS FOURTH-QUARTER 2025 FINANCIAL RESULTS AFFIRMS KEY CLINICAL DEVELOPMENT MILESTONES
- Patient dosing initiated in PROPEL-IPF, a global Phase 2 trial evaluating PIPE-791 for the treatment of patients with idiopathic pulmonary fibrosis (IPF)
- Topline data from the exploratory PIPE-791 Phase 1b trial in patients with chronic pain is expected in the second quarter of 2026
SAN DIEGO - March 5, 2026 - Contineum Therapeutics, Inc. (NASDAQ CTNM) (Contineum or the Company), a clinical-stage biopharmaceutical company pioneering differentiated therapies for the treatment of neuroscience, inflammation and immunology (NI I) indications, today reported its fourth-quarter 2025 financial results and affirmed its key clinical development milestones.

Key Clinical Development Milestones
Contineum has initiated patient dosing in PROPEL-IPF, a global Phase 2 clinical trial evaluating PIPE-791 for the treatment of patients with IPF. PROPEL-IPF is a 26-week, randomized, double-blind, placebo-controlled clinical trial evaluating the efficacy, safety, tolerability and pharmacokinetics of once-daily, oral PIPE-791 in approximately 324 IPF patients. The primary efficacy endpoint is the change from baseline through week 26 in absolute forced vital capacity (FVC mL). More information on this trial can be found at https clinicaltrials.gov (NCT07284459).
The Company anticipates reporting topline data from its exploratory PIPE-791 Phase 1b trial in patients with chronic osteoarthritis pain or chronic lower back pain in the second quarter of 2026. This randomized, double-blind, placebo-controlled, crossover trial initiated patient dosing in March 2025. More information on this trial can be found at https clinicaltrials.gov (NCT06810245).
In December 2024, Johnson Johnson began recruiting an estimated 124 adult participants for a Phase 2 Moonlight-1 trial of PIPE-307 JNJ-89495120. This randomized, double-blind, multicenter, placebo-controlled, proof-of-concept trial is evaluating the efficacy, safety and tolerability of PIPE-307 JNJ-89495120 as
monotherapy in adult participants with major depressive disorder (MDD). More information on this trial can be found at https clinicaltrials.gov (NCT06785012).
Fourth-Quarter 2025 Financial Results
Cash, cash equivalents and marketable securities were $262.9 million as of December 31, 2025. Contineum believes its cash resources are sufficient to fund its planned operations through mid-2029. During the fourth quarter, the Company completed an upsized public offering that generated net proceeds of $93.0 million from the issuance of approximately 8.1 million shares of Class A common stock at a price of $12.25.
Research and development expenses were $12.8 million, a 2 percent decrease from the fourth quarter of 2024. This decrease was primarily driven by a reduction in expenses related to the completion of the Company's PIPE-307 VISTA trial and lower costs for the CTX-343 program, partially offset by increased expenses for the PIPE-791 programs and higher employee-related costs.
General and administrative expenses were $4.4 million, an 8 percent increase from the fourth quarter of 2024. The increase was primarily driven by higher stock-based compensation and employee-related costs.
Net loss was $15.2 million for the three months ended December 31, 2025, as compared to $14.6 million for the prior-year quarter.
About Contineum Therapeutics
Contineum Therapeutics (Nasdaq CTNM) is a clinical-stage biopharmaceutical company pioneering novel, oral small molecule therapies for NI I indications with significant unmet need. Contineum is advancing a pipeline of internally-developed programs with multiple drug candidates now in clinical trials. PIPE-791 is an LPA1 receptor antagonist in clinical development for idiopathic pulmonary fibrosis and chronic pain. PIPE-307 is a selective inhibitor of the M1 receptor in clinical development for relapsing-remitting multiple sclerosis and major depressive disorder.
